Compare all specifications:
1995 Renault Laguna | 1996 Volvo 850 | |
Make | Renault | Volvo |
Model | Laguna | 850 |
Year Released | 1995 | 1996 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1868 cc | 1984 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 5 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 97 HP | 124 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 6100 RPM |
Torque | 200 Nm | 170 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 4800 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1435 kg | 1390 kg |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1420 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2680 mm | 2670 mm |
